Deprioritization is the temporary slowing of your data speeds during times of network congestion, whereas throttling is the slowing of your data speeds to almost unusable speeds once you’ve met your monthly data allowance.This article will cover the primary differences between data deprioritization and data throttling to help you … metadata has jdbc-type of null

From the Test box at the top of the page, select “speedtest” and click “Go!” to see your HTTP … WebNov 17, 2024 · Spectrum also agreed to stop the “cap on data” practice for seven years. While not the same thing as bandwidth throttling, some ISPs with a data cap policy throttle the Internet speeds of their customers who exceed their monthly data allowance. Others charge an overage fee; for example AT&T’s runs $10 for each 50 GB of data consumed …
